Understanding 9mm Frangible Ammunition
Frangible ammo is designed to disintegrate upon impact, minimizing the risk of ricochets and overpenetration. This makes it ideal for indoor ranges, close-quarters training, or any situation where a projectile's trajectory beyond the target is a critical concern. The core characteristic of 9mm frangible ammunition is its unique construction, using materials like powdered metal or ceramic that fragment on impact.
How Frangible Ammo Works
Unlike traditional full metal jacket (FMJ) rounds that retain their shape upon impact, 9mm frangible rounds are engineered to break apart on contact. This fragmentation significantly reduces the risk of the bullet passing through the target and continuing its trajectory, potentially causing harm or damage to what's beyond. This unique characteristic of frangible 9mm ammo makes it a safer choice for specific applications.
Advantages of Using Frangible Ammo
- Reduced Risk of Ricochets: The disintegration upon impact significantly lessens the chance of dangerous ricochets, enhancing safety in confined spaces.
- Minimal Overpenetration: This is the primary benefit. Frangible rounds fragment upon impact, dramatically reducing their ability to penetrate walls, barriers, or other materials beyond the target.
- Indoor Range Safety: This makes it particularly suitable for indoor shooting ranges, improving safety for both shooters and range personnel.
- Specific Training Scenarios: Its safety profile makes it beneficial for specialized training exercises requiring controlled environments and reduced risk of collateral damage.
Disadvantages of Using Frangible Ammo
- Higher Cost: Frangible ammo generally costs more than traditional FMJ rounds due to its complex manufacturing process.
- Reduced Velocity: Frangible rounds often have lower velocities compared to their FMJ counterparts, potentially impacting accuracy at longer ranges.
- Less Consistent Performance: Factors like the material used and impact angle can influence the consistency of fragmentation. Some manufacturers might exhibit greater reliability in this area.
- Potential for Residue: Some frangible ammo can leave behind more residue in the firearm than traditional rounds. Regular cleaning is crucial.

Safety Precautions When Using Frangible Ammo
While designed for safety, frangible ammo still requires careful handling:
- Eye and Ear Protection: Always wear appropriate eye and ear protection when firing any ammunition, including frangible rounds.
- Proper Ventilation: Indoor ranges should have adequate ventilation to mitigate the potential for increased particulate matter in the air.
- Clean Your Firearm Regularly: The unique composition of frangible ammo may leave more residue in the firearm, requiring more frequent cleaning.
- Follow Manufacturer's Instructions: Always read and follow the manufacturer's instructions for both the ammunition and the firearm.
